It is an international agreement that establishes the legal framework for marine and maritime activities. It came into existence in 1982. It is also known as Law of the Sea. It divides marine areas into five main zones namely- Internal Waters, Territorial Sea, Contiguous Zone, Exclusive Economic Zone (EEZ) and the High Seas. In 1995, India ratified the UNCLOS.
